The third chapter of the Peninsular Divide arrives in 2026, inviting cyclists to etch their names into the folklore of Southeast Asian ultra-endurance racing. “Episode 3: The Legend Continues” is far more than a race; it is a 1,500km traverse that captures the raw, unfiltered soul of Malaysia, stretching from the southern tip of the peninsula all the way to the northern border. Riders will face a staggering 20,000 meters of vertical gain as they transition from sun-drenched coastal roads to the oxygen-thin, emerald corridors of the Titiwangsa Range. This journey offers an unparalleled immersion into the nation’s geography, guiding you through ancient rainforests, vast rubber estates, and the iconic, rolling tea plantations of the highlands.

 

To participate is to embrace the true spirit of self-supported adventure, where the road ahead is as unpredictable as the tropical climate. Participants must navigate a complex tapestry of terrains, ranging from smooth, heat-radiating tarmac to rugged gravel paths that demand both physical grit and technical finesse. Beyond the sheer physical struggle, the magic of the Peninsular Divide lies in the cultural rhythm of the route. You will find your strength at midnight “Warungs” (roadside stalls) fueled by the genuine hospitality of locals and the legendary kick of Malaysian street food, turning every refueling stop into a vibrant story of its own.

 

The challenge is compounded by the equatorial elements, where the humid heat of the day often gives way to the dramatic intensity of the monsoon season. This constant dance with the weather requires a unique mental fortitude, forcing racers to adapt to sudden downpours and the steam-rising asphalt of the tropics. As you push toward the finish line among the striking limestone karsts of the north, you aren’t just completing a distance; you are surviving a legend and witnessing the breathtaking diversity of Malaysia from the seat of a bicycle.
